BBQ Chickpea Meatballs

Image Credit: Spoonful Wanderer.

These savory BBQ Chickpea Meatballs pack a flavorful punch with their blend of chickpeas, oats, and smoky seasonings. A quick whirl in the food processor transforms simple ingredients into golden-brown meatballs that freeze beautifully for up to 3 months. Just pop them in the oven straight from the freezer, and you’ll have tender, protein-rich meatballs in minutes.

Toss these hearty meatballs with your favorite BBQ sauce and serve them over creamy mashed potatoes or fluffy rice. They make fantastic sub sandwiches loaded with melted cheese and caramelized onions. For a lighter option, add them to a crisp salad or wrap them in lettuce leaves with crunchy vegetables.

Dairy-free Mac and Cheese

Image Credit: Spoonful Wanderer.

Craving the comfort of mac and cheese but can’t do dairy? This creamy, rich version will knock your socks off! Made with cashews, potatoes, and carrots, this sauce brings all the smooth, cheesy goodness you want without any dairy. The secret? A quick blend of simple ingredients creates a sauce so silky and satisfying, you’ll want to pour it on everything.

Serve this hearty dish with roasted broccoli or crispy Brussels sprouts to add some green to your plate. For extra zing, top with toasted breadcrumbs and a sprinkle of paprika. This meal freezes beautifully – just thaw overnight and reheat with a splash of water to bring back that perfect consistency.
